What Makes NextStar Energy A Top Battery Brand In Canada?
NextStar Energy stands out as a leading battery brand in Canada due to its pioneering large-scale EV battery plant in Windsor, Ontario, a joint venture between Stellantis and LG Energy Solution. With a 49.5 GWh annual production capacity, advanced lithium-ion technology, job creation, and a strong sustainability focus, NextStar is shaping Canada’s clean energy and electric mobility future.
How Is NextStar Energy’s Windsor Facility Unique in Canada?
NextStar Energy is establishing Canada’s first large-scale domestic EV battery manufacturing plant. The Windsor facility will produce 49.5 GWh annually, supporting electric vehicle adoption nationwide. Its scale enables mass production of high-quality lithium-ion cells and modules, positioning Canada as a major player in North America’s battery supply chain while fostering local innovation and skilled workforce growth.

How Does NextStar Energy Support Job Creation and Workforce Development?
The CAD 5 billion investment generates over 2,500 direct jobs and additional opportunities in logistics, supply, and research. Programs like Battery Boost train skilled technicians and engineers for the battery sector. NextStar Energy’s approach ensures a diverse, technically proficient workforce, preparing Canada to meet growing EV and energy storage market needs while fostering long-term economic growth.
Chart: Job Impact by Sector
| Sector | Jobs Created | Notes |
|---|---|---|
| Manufacturing | 2,500 | Direct plant employment |
| Logistics & Supply | 1,200 | Materials and distribution |
| R&D & Training | 600 | Battery Boost & innovation programs |
